Today many enterprises allow personal devices to connect to the enterprise network. CIOs like this trend because it reduces the cost of hardware, empowers the employee, improves productivity and responsiveness as well as increases employee satisfaction. However, this also introduces a non-standard environment to the mission critical IT infrastructure, plays havoc with the technology roadmap, impacts support and has the potential to expose organization to increased security threats.

CONZebra's BYOD-BP Service Offering CONZebra's new BYOD Baseline Policy service addresses data theft, malware, wireless exploits, and provides proprietary data loss monitoring and access management. BYOD-BP, based on the COBIT framework, is designed to help organizations create a common set of procedures that form a foundation for establishing a corporate BYOD policy. CONZebra will work closely with an organization to: - Evaluate Each Operation: Organizations need to take inventory of their critical infrastructure and documents that are vital to business decisions and then determine their risk exposure levels. In addition organizations need to take a physical inventory of their devices.


- Map Everything: Every organization needs a map to identify responsible pathways to reduce exposure to risky business practices. In addition it is important to define virtualization parameters for operation to make sure these align with your map and to create a key to identify key applications for BYOD access.

- Develop a BYOD Policy: Once a baseline is determined an organization needs to create a corporate BYOD policy that includes acceptable usage policies.

- Implement it: Once ethical user guidelines have been established they need to be applied.

- Conduct Audits: Once a quarter an inventory of critical infrastructure needs to be conducted and reviewed as well as the policy to make sure it is still appropriate.
